The speed of a particle moving in a circle of radius r=2m varies with time t as v=t2 where t is in second and v is in ms−1 . Find the net acceleration at t=2s .
The linear speed of the particle at t=2s is v=22=4ms−1 ∴ Radial acceleration ar=rv2=2(4)2=8ms−2
The tangential acceleration is at=dtdv=2t ∴ Tangential acceleration at t=2s is at=(2)(2)=4ms−2 ∴ Net acceleration of at t=2s is a=(ar)2+(at)2=(8)2+(4)2
Or a=80ms−2
